A vacuum sealer works its magic by removing air—specifically oxygen—from a specialized bag or container before sealing it airtight. Why is this a big deal? Oxygen is the primary culprit behind food spoilage, causing oxidation, freezer burn, and the growth of bacteria and mold. By eliminating it, a good vacuum sealer creates an environment where your food stays fresher, longer, often extending shelf life by three to five times compared to traditional storage methods. This means your meats, fruits, vegetables, and even pantry staples like coffee beans and nuts retain their flavor, texture, and nutritional value for weeks or even months.

Understanding the Types of Vacuum Sealers

Before you choose a good vacuum sealer, it’s helpful to know the different kinds available, as each serves slightly different needs.

External/Suction Sealers

These are the most common and often the go-to for home kitchens. They work by placing the open end of a specially textured bag into the machine, which then sucks out the air and heat-seals it.

  • Pros: Generally more affordable, compact, and easy to store. Great for solid foods, pre-portioned meals, and protecting items from freezer burn.
  • Cons: Can struggle with liquids or very moist foods, as the liquid might get drawn into the machine, compromising the seal. Require textured bags which can be more expensive.
  • Ideal for: Everyday home use, meal prepping, storing bulk purchases of meat, cheese, and vegetables.

Chamber Sealers

You’ll typically find these in professional kitchens, but smaller versions are becoming popular for serious home cooks. With a chamber sealer, the entire bag is placed inside a chamber, and the air is removed from the whole chamber, creating an equally pressurized environment inside and outside the bag.

  • Pros: Excellent for sealing liquids, marinades, and delicate foods without crushing them. Creates incredibly strong and reliable seals. Can use cheaper, smooth bags.
  • Cons: Significantly more expensive and much larger, requiring dedicated counter space.
  • Ideal for: Sous vide enthusiasts, bulk processors, hunters, and anyone frequently sealing liquids or large quantities.

Handheld Sealers

These compact, often cordless devices are designed for occasional use and usually work with special zipper bags or containers with a vacuum valve.

  • Pros: Extremely portable, space-saving, and quick for small jobs.
  • Cons: Less powerful vacuum, not suitable for long-term freezer storage of all foods.
  • Ideal for: Sealing pantry staples like cereals, cold cuts, cheese, or for quick on-the-go freshness.

Key Features That Define a Good Vacuum Sealer

So, what should you really look for when investing in a vacuum sealer? A truly good vacuum sealer combines robust performance with user-friendly features.

Sealing Power and Modes: Beyond the Basic Seal

The ability to customize the sealing process is a hallmark of a good vacuum sealer.

  • Dry/Moist Settings: This is a must-have. A “moist” setting ensures a strong seal even with residual liquids, preventing liquid from being drawn into the vacuum pump. The “dry” setting is perfect for solid foods.
  • Pulse/Gentle Mode: For delicate items like berries, bread, or soft pastries, a pulse function allows you to manually control the vacuum pressure, preventing crushing. This gives you more control over the vacuum strength.
  • Double Seal: Some high-end models offer a double heat seal, providing an extra layer of security, especially for long-term storage or sous vide cooking.

Durability and Build Quality: Built to Last

A good vacuum sealer is an investment, so you want one that can stand the test of time.

  • Materials: Look for models made with durable, high-quality materials like stainless steel or BPA-free plastics. These are not only robust but also easier to clean.
  • Vacuum Pump and Sealing Bar: The quality of these internal components directly impacts performance and longevity. A strong pump ensures consistent air removal, and a reliable sealing bar creates an airtight closure every time. Check reviews for insights into long-term durability.

Convenience Features: Making Life Easier

The best vacuum sealers often include thoughtful features that streamline the sealing process.

  • Integrated Roll Storage and Cutter: This feature is a real time-saver. It allows you to store a roll of vacuum bags right within the machine and cut custom-sized bags with an integrated cutter, reducing waste and clutter.
  • Removable Drip Tray: If you’re sealing juicy meats or marinated foods, spills happen. A removable, dishwasher-safe drip tray makes cleanup a breeze and protects your countertop.
  • Accessory Port: Many good vacuum sealers come with an accessory port, allowing you to attach a hose for vacuum sealing jars, canisters, or even wine bottles with specialized attachments. This expands your food preservation options significantly.
  • Ease of Use (Automatic vs. Manual): While automatic sealers offer one-touch convenience, some users prefer a manual mode for greater control, especially with varied food types. A good vacuum sealer strikes a balance, offering both intuitive automatic operation and manual override options.

Size and Storage: Fitting Your Kitchen and Lifestyle

Consider your kitchen space and how often you’ll use the sealer.

  • Countertop vs. Compact: If you’re a frequent user or have ample counter space, a larger countertop model might be ideal. For smaller kitchens or occasional use, a compact or handheld model that can be easily stored might be a better fit.
  • Portability: Some models are designed to be lightweight and easy to move, which is great if you plan to store it away after each use.

Speed and Efficiency: Sealing Smarter, Not Harder

If you plan to seal large batches, the speed and efficiency of your vacuum sealer matter.

  • Continuous Use: Some consumer-grade models require cool-down periods between seals. A good vacuum sealer for bulk processing will have a higher duty cycle, allowing for more continuous operation without overheating.

How to Use Your Vacuum Sealer Effectively: A Step-by-Step Guide

Getting the most out of your vacuum sealer means knowing how to use it right.

  1. Prepare Your Food: Always ensure your food is clean and dry before sealing. Excess moisture can interfere with the seal. For very juicy items, consider pre-freezing them slightly or placing a folded paper towel in the bag (away from the seal area) to absorb extra liquid.
  2. Choose the Right Bag/Roll: Use high-quality, BPA-free vacuum sealer bags or rolls compatible with your machine. Rolls are fantastic for customizing bag sizes and minimizing waste.
  3. Fill the Bag: Don’t overfill! Leave at least 2-3 inches of space between the food and the top edge of the bag to ensure a good seal. For rolls, remember to leave enough room for both seals if you’re cutting from a roll.
  4. Position and Seal: Place the open end of the bag into the vacuum sealer’s sealing channel. Ensure it’s flat and free of wrinkles. Close the lid (some have a satisfying click when ready) and select your desired setting (e.g., dry, moist, gentle). The machine will remove the air and then heat-seal the bag.
  5. Store: Once sealed, label your bags with the date and contents before storing them in the pantry, fridge, or freezer.

Common Mistakes to Avoid with Your Vacuum Sealer

Even with a good vacuum sealer, user error can undermine its benefits.

  • Overfilling Bags: As mentioned, leaving insufficient space prevents a proper, airtight seal.
  • Not Cleaning Regularly: Food particles or liquids can accumulate in the drip tray or sealing area, affecting performance and hygiene. Empty the drip tray and wipe down the sealing area after each use.
  • Ignoring Bag Compatibility: Not all bags are created equal. Ensure you’re using bags specifically designed for vacuum sealing and compatible with your machine (e.g., textured bags for external sealers).
  • Sealing Liquids Incorrectly: Trying to vacuum seal a bowl of soup with an external sealer is a recipe for a mess and a failed seal. For liquids, use a chamber sealer, or pre-freeze the liquid into a solid block before vacuum sealing with an external model.

Beyond Preservation: Unexpected Applications of Your Vacuum Sealer

A good vacuum sealer isn’t just for food; it’s a versatile tool for your home.

  • Sous Vide Cooking: This popular cooking method relies on vacuum-sealed food cooked in a precise temperature water bath. A vacuum sealer ensures consistent results and locks in flavors.
  • Rapid Marinating: The vacuum pressure opens up the pores of meat, allowing marinades to penetrate much faster – turning hours of marinating into minutes!
  • Protecting Valuables: Keep important documents, jewelry, or emergency supplies safe from moisture and air when stored in vacuum-sealed bags.
  • Emergency Preparedness: Vacuum seal first-aid kits, matches, and other survival essentials to protect them from the elements.

FAQs about Good Vacuum Sealers

Q: How long does vacuum-sealed food actually last?

A: Vacuum sealing can extend the shelf life of food significantly. For example, fresh meat might last 1-2 weeks in the fridge when vacuum-sealed, compared to just 2-3 days normally. In the freezer, it can last 2-3 years instead of 6-12 months, largely preventing freezer burn.

Q: Can I vacuum seal liquids with any machine?

A: While external vacuum sealers can struggle with liquids, chamber vacuum sealers are designed to handle them with ease. If you only have an external sealer, a common trick is to freeze liquids or very moist foods solid before vacuum sealing to prevent them from being sucked into the machine.

Q: What’s the difference between smooth and textured bags?

A: Textured (or embossed) bags have a special pattern that allows air to be drawn out more effectively by external vacuum sealers. Smooth bags are typically used with chamber vacuum sealers, where the entire bag is within the vacuum environment. Ensure you use the correct bag type for your machine.

Q: How do I clean and maintain my vacuum sealer?

A: Regular cleaning is key. Wipe down the sealing bar and vacuum channel after each use, especially if sealing moist foods. If your model has a removable drip tray, clean it thoroughly. Consult your owner’s manual for specific cleaning instructions and any maintenance tips, such as checking gaskets.
